Elements & performance criteria

1 Determine job requirements

  • 1.1Follow standard operating procedures (SOPs)
  • 1.2Comply with work health and safety (WHS) requirements at all times
  • 1.3Undertake consultations and briefings with managers, employers and customers to determine application requirements

2 Determine metal forming and shaping process to suit application requirements

  • 2.1Identify and research sources of information appropriate to metal forming and shaping
  • 2.2Select the relevant scientific techniques and principles of metal forming and shaping and associated software and hardware technologies
  • 2.3Use appropriate calculations and coherent units in the solution of engineering calculations
  • 2.4Use significant figures in engineering calculations
  • 2.5Determine metal forming and shaping requirements

3 Supervise metal forming and shaping processes

  • 3.1Communicate metal forming and shaping parameters to appropriate personnel
  • 3.2Supervise metal forming and shaping processes to ensure required solutions are achieved
  • 3.3Evaluate metal forming and shaping processes and advise on defects

Performance evidence

  • following work instructions, standard operating procedures (SOPs) and safe work practices
  • undertaking consultations with relevant personnel and researching other sources of information including industry codes and standards in applying metallurgical principles and practice to determining metal forming and shaping processes appropriate to the application
  • selecting scientific principles to suit applications
  • selecting basic mechanical techniques and associated technologies, software and hardware to suit applications on at least two occasions
  • applying and manipulating appropriate formulas for applications involving engineering calculations
  • applying appropriate calculations to engineering situations
  • referring solutions to the original aim of the application
  • quoting solutions in appropriate units, using appropriate significant figures
  • quoting limitations of solutions, due to assumptions, scientific principles and techniques used
  • presenting and recommending solutions

Knowledge evidence

  • safe work practices and procedures
  • sources of information
  • metallurgical principles and practices
  • plastic deformation of metals
  • scientific principles, techniques and associated technologies, software and hardware to suit different applications
  • lubrication of metal surfaces
  • metal forming and shaping principles and methods, including: - physical and mechanical principles of the deformation process - industrial practices - equipment and process design - typical product defects - advantages and disadvantages of: - rolling - forging - extrusion - wire drawing - tube manufacture - sheet metal forming, deep drawing and pressing - powder metallurgy
